Aaaargh, I know that "Hush Hush"one. I think the Poozies/Sileas sing it, but I'm not sure. Either it's them or it's just a friend of mine who sings it. I'll ask him when I see him. Another grim but very beautiful one is on Catherine-Ann MacPhee's "Canan Nan Gailheal"called "An Nighean Nan Geng Taladh" which is about a dead mother coming back as a ghost because their step-parents beat her children. Must be very reassuring if you're a kid.*G* The album has only the one lullaby but since it is very beautiful I though I'd mention it anyway. Sophie
